And the "coincidence" here is even less surprising when we note the substantial differences: Lincoln was killed indoors with a small handgun at point blank range; Kennedy was shot outdoors with a rifle from several hundred feet away. The Lincolns lost Willie while in the White House, while the Kennedys lost Patrick Bouvier, who was NOT (as some pages erroneously state) a miscarriage, but a premature baby who lived two days. Oswald was born (and lived most of his life) in near poverty-level circumstances, never knew his father (who died two months before Oswald was born) and was an obscure, moody malcontent who never had any close friends or a steady job. This "coincidence" is even less surprising when we consider that presidential elections are held only once every four years. Likewise, Kennedy couldn't possibly have been elected President in the non-election years of 1957, 1958, 1959, 1961, 1962, or 1963.
